Ink: SUNFLOWER
Description: This fabulously shaped 'Sunflower' ink has a series of raised bumps along the outside edge, a flat top and a characteristic offset neck. Crude flat base. Burst lip. Full original external sheen. Scarce and desirable. Not so often seen in such great condition (better in fact than the photos would suggest)
Era: c1870-1890's
Dimensions: 36mm in height (to top of lip)/ 70mm diameter across body
Condition (please see detailed photo's): Excellent Great condition with just the odd insignificant small flake on the very inside of the top of the lip (barely visible and nothing untoward) and is otherwise mint
